1. Belém Tower: Lisbon’s Riverside Icon

Belém Tower stands guard over the Tagus—a 16th-century fortress etched with Manueline stone carvings. Its ramparts sweep the river with views, a sentinel of Portugal’s seafaring days. It’s not just a tower; it’s Lisbon’s maritime soul, a beacon of history calling for a linger.

  • Pro Tip: Visit early to dodge crowds and catch the morning light.

2. Alfama District: Old Soul of Lisbon

Alfama weaves Lisbon’s ancient tale—narrow lanes twist past tiled homes, where fado’s mournful notes spill from taverns. It’s a labyrinth of charm, alive with echoes of the past. It’s not just a district; it’s Lisbon’s beating heart, a living relic of culture and song.

3. LX Factory: Creative Haven

LX Factory rises from Lisbon’s industrial ashes—a reborn hub where warehouses hum with galleries, cafes, and quirky shops. Local talent sparks the air, blending grit with inspiration. It’s not just a complex; it’s Lisbon’s modern pulse, a playground for the bold and curious.

4. Praça do Comércio: Riverside Grandeur

Praça do Comércio opens wide along the Tagus—a grand square framed by yellow arches and the Triumphal Arch’s quiet pride. It’s a space to breathe, to snap a shot, to feel Lisbon’s spirit. It’s not just a plaza; it’s the city’s riverside soul, a gateway to its storied past.

5. Sintra’s Pena Palace: Fairy-Tale Heights

Pena Palace crowns a lush hill near Lisbon—its turrets blaze red, yellow, and blue in Romantic whimsy. Panoramas stretch from its perch, a royal retreat turned dreamer’s delight. It’s not just a palace; it’s Portugal’s fairy-tale escape, a vibrant echo of regal days.
